China: Culture, Content, Contract
May 8th, 2017 | 10:00 AM – 4:00 PM
Join the Utah Office of Tourism for a day of immersion as guest speakers walk delegates through the nuances of working with the Chinese market. The day is designed to offer an in-depth look at best practices and contracting while providing ideas on how to welcome Chinese visitors to your business. The cost per person is $65 and includes a Chinese cuisine lunch.
Tracy Lanza, with Brand USA, will identify how Chinese travelers consume content and best practices for the Industry to reach potential visitors through strategic marketing practices.
Charlie Gu, with China Luxury Advisors, will share details about Chinese culture and how it affects consumers’ purchase decisions, including research, booking and actual travel. Insight into what Chinese travelers expect when they visit Utah will be discussed.
Rachel Bremer, UOT Global Marketing Manager, will discuss the tourism inventory contracting process. She will then lead an expert panel discussion with receptive tour operators and suppliers to help all delegates learn from best practices and take next steps.
